Job Title: Maintenance Officer
Department: Housing
Responsible To: Property and Housing Manager
1.GENERAL RESPONSIBILITIES
- The role of the Maintenance Officer is to ensure that Fold Ireland Housing Association provides an efficient, cost effective, good quality repairs and maintenance service for all properties it manages.
- The Maintenance Officer will play a key role in the day-to-day delivery of the repairs and maintenance service.
- The Maintenance Officer will liaise closely with Housing Management staff and have a dual responsibility with estate inspections and services.
- Provide expert advice and information to Housing with Care Managers, tenants and residents in response to requests for repairs and maintenance.
- The post holder will support responsive and planned maintenance programmes while ensuring properties remain safe, compliant and fit for purpose.
2. SPECIFIC DUTIES
2.1 Day to Day Repairs
- Carry out pre and post inspections for repairs
- Operate the Associations computerised repairs system including call logging, recording repairs and the production of works orders.
- Review contractor’s invoices for rates charges, hours worked and material charges.
- Identify rechargeable repairs and insurance claims in line with the Associations Maintenance Policy.
- Monitor response times regularly for completing repairs in order to measure contractor performance.
- Ensure all works are completed in line with health & safety and statutory compliance requirements
2.2 Approved Contractors
- Operate a list of approved contractors.
- Ensure that any contractors on approved list are suitably qualified for the type of work they undertake and have all the necessary documentation required to be an approved contractor in place.
- Oversee the work of approved contractors in a professional manner and monitor performance against KPI’S, value for money and quality.
2.3 Asset & Planned Maintenance Responsibilities
- Assist the Housing / Estates officer, Housing manager and external consultants in the production of planned and cyclical maintenance programs.
- Oversee and co-ordinate planned and cyclical maintenance programs including the annual servicing of gas boilers to tenanted properties.
- Carry out and maintain a rolling programme of stock condition surveys
- Responsible for the development and delivery of an active AMS. Features of the AMS includes a strong evidence-based understanding of stock performance which facilitates both the maintenance and enhancement of the stock to meet the changing needs and expectations of our customers as well as regulatory requirements.
- Maintain a continuing programme of Stock Condition Surveys a stock database which underpins investment decisions.
- Producing detailed long-term investment programmes. Maintaining a 30-year projection of maintenance spending Assessing, drafting specifications, tendering, procuring, and managing contracts to maximize investment for planned and cyclical works.
- Manage contracts for planned works to ensure quality compliance and value for money.
2.4 Void Properties
- Inspect and assess vacant properties and organise repairs where necessary and ensure all work is completed to the required standards and as quickly as possible to minimize rental loss.
- Arrange removal of personal belongings and clearance works where requires Add a bullet Ensure properties meet lettable standards before reallocation.
- Liaise closely with Housing Management staff to ensure prospective tenants can view void houses.
- Attend and contribute to regular maintenance meetings.
2.5 Out of Hours
- Respond to out of hours calls as necessary and occasionally attend on site if the situation arises in line with our Business continuity plan.
- Attend as necessary out of hour’s committee meetings, resident’s association meetings, training courses, seminars and conferences.
2.6 New Build Development
- Liaise with Development staff from an early stage on new build specifications and products.
- Attend onsite inspections during the construction phase to gain knowledge of the buildings fabric and services.
- Contribute to smooth handover of the building from the contractor to ensure all the necessary procedures and documentation is received as per the Association’s policy.
- Support defects inspections and ensure defects are resolved within the liability periods
2.7 Estate and Property Management
- Carry out regular estate and close inspections and order necessary repairs.
- Oversee landscape contractor and report and instruct any remedial works.
- Liaise closely with Housing Staff on estate management issues and services.
- Identify and report health and safety hazards within estates and monitor communal areas
2.8 Customer Care
- Respond to all the Association customers (residents and others) in a prompt, polite and efficient manner and deal with any complaints as per the housing associations complaints handing policy and procedure.
- Where required assess customer satisfaction with the repair and maintenance service and co-ordinate the production of information leaflets about the service.
- Promote a customer focused repairs service with clear communications and timely updates
2.9 Miscellaneous
- Work closely with all other staff from the Association to ensure the delivery of all services is efficient and effective to all its customers.
- Ensure compliance with health and safety legislation fire safety standards and relevant housing regulations.
- Carry out other specific tasks as instructed by the Property and Housing Manager.
